Tally Printer Job Stuck In Queue

A Tally printer job stuck in queue is a very common printer-related issue. Documents when commanded by you to get printed do not directly get printed by the computer if there is another document that is waiting to be printed. All the documents which are to be printed go into the print queue and then they are printed one by one. When there are a lot of print commands given, the issue of document stuck in tally printer queue arises. Here is how to clear the print queue on your computer

How to solve tally printer items stuck in queue

Solution 1

  1. Open the start menu on your computer
  2. To go to the start menu. Press the Windows key or click on the Windows logo appearing on your computer screen
  3. Type in settings on the search panel and click ok
  4. This will take you to the settings of your computer
  5. In the settings, look for printer settings and click on it
  6. The setting of the printer will come up. Find the “print queue” option and click on it
  7. In the next step, click on “Cancel all documents”
  8. The print queue will be cleared and there will be no print commands left, you can either start printing again right away or you can choose to restart the print spooler in order to fix the Tally print stuck in queue
  9. Open the run command box on the Windows computer.
  10. To open the run command box, Press the R key along with the Windows key together at the same time.
  11. An empty search box will appear on the screen
  12. In the search window that appeared, type “services.msc”
  13. All the services currently running on your computer or are disabled will show up on the screen
  14. Navigate to the “Print spooler service”
  15. Right-click on the print spooler 
  16. A new menu will appear. Click on “Stop” and the printer spooler will be temporarily disabled on your computer.
  17. To fix the tally printer items stuck in queue, proceed to the next steps
  18. Navigate to the Windows folder which can be found on the drive where the operating system is installed 
  19. Look for system 32 folders inside the Windows folder and double-click on it to open
  20. Go inside the spool folder and then to the printer folder
  21. You will see a number of cache files. Select all of the files and press the delete button on your keyboard, or right-click on the chosen files and select “delete all”.
  22. Go back to the services window and restart the print spooler service by selecting the print spooler and clicking on the “Start” button.

The issue of a document stuck in tally printer queue will be cleared after restarting the print spooler service.

Solution 2

A Tally Printer Job stuck in Queue can be caused by reasons other than overloading of the print queue. This solution is designed for you to understand the problem and solve the issue of a document stuck in tally printer queue. First, you have to check the connections, check the print rollers, and then update the tally printer drivers. 

Here is how to fix the tally print stuck in queue step by step

  1. Verify that the printer, as well as the computer, are connected to the exact same wifi network 
  2. If one of the devices is connected with the extension, connect it to the same wifi
  3. Check the internet connection to make sure the signal strength is good
  4. Checking signal strength is very necessary to fix Tally Printer Job stuck in Queue
  5. If the USB cable that connects the printer’s port to your machine has been damaged, alternatively replace it. If the wire was accidentally ripped. 
  6. Unlock the front door of the printer.
  7. Clean the rollers that are on the printer.
  8. Shut the printer’s doors.
  9. Navigate to the tally printer website using your web browser.
  10. Navigate to the website’s Support space and select the equipment type. Click on “Printing devices”.
  11. Choose your device type or printer model.
  12. Click “driver updates” and select your operating system.
  13. Clicking “Download driver” will download the most recent printer drivers.
  14. Open the downloads folder on your computer
  15. Click on the printer driver setup 
  16. Click on the “Next” button
  17. Click on “Install” and agree to the terms and conditions

After the driver is updated successfully, restart the printer give a print command, and wait for a minute to determine if the Tally print job stuck in queue error is solved or not.
